Output 2878331657ad7037c831bd01928a753f799eeb3f3c609a141c1d3901f589c654:7

value
17950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c09265b9aaf9902853c37bd6969f9d5eb4f12984 OP_EQUAL
address
3KFF3F1fEMqc7YBr7UWYy1wfqePMiPCs6N
transaction
2878331657ad7037c831bd01928a753f799eeb3f3c609a141c1d3901f589c654
confirmations
419351
spent
true